Neutral Citation No. - 2025:AHC:48133 Court No. - 47 Case :- CRIMINAL MISC. BAIL APPLICATION No. - 27326 of 2024 Applicant :- Ajay Singh Opposite Party :- State of U.P. Counsel for Applicant :- Jitendra Singh Counsel for Opposite Party :- G.A. Hon'ble Siddharth,J. Heard learned counsel for the applicant and learned A.G.A for the State. There are allegations against the applicant of making attempt on the life of the injured.. Learned counsel for the applicant submits that it is a case of sudden provocation. There was no prior intention or planning to commit alleged offence The applicant is in jail since 8.6.2024 and has criminal history of one case to his credit. On the other hand learned A.G.A has opposed the prayer for bail. Keeping in view the nature of the offence, evidence, complicity of the accused, submissions of the learned counsel for the parties noted above, finding force in the submissions made by the learned counsel for the applicant, larger mandate of the Article 21 of the Constitution of India, considering the dictum of Apex Court in the case of Dataram Singh Vs.
